So, I've had the car for a couple of months now and I think I am done modding it for now. Brief mod list includes, CF Lip, CF big fin diffuser, quad tips exhaust, window tint, SLS style grille, LED tail light bulbs and LED side markers.

Can't lower the car, cause I will winter drive it. With the lip it already scrapes snow, so lowering it is out of the question. Would love to hear your guy's comments, suggestions and opinions.

They replace the resonator with the x-pipe. It's not obnoxious at all, the only time it's loud is when you are pushing the car past 4K RPMs. It's very quiet and sounds stock with normal city driving or cruising on the highway.
